| Özet |
| This study investigates effects of static versus kinematic CSRS-PPP processing on coordinate differences (Δ φ, Δ λ, Δ h) during the 2023 Kahramanmaraş earthquake sequence in Türkiye. GNSS data from TNPGN-Active stations MAR1 and ANTE are analyzed across 10 pre-seismic days (January 28-February 6, 2023) using two approaches: daily spectral analysis with median filtering, detrending and FFT and combined analysis of concatenated time series. Results show processing modes produce discrepancies exceeding 35% in dominant frequency characteristics and 68% in spectral variance. We observe a counterintuitive distance paradox: ANTE station exhibits 87.5% higher baseline frequency variability despite being 46% farther from the epicenter than MAR1.
